Playdough is one of our most favorite things to do at our house for kids of all ages. Even my 10 year old will spend hours kneading and shaping this wonderful dough. It is great for open ended play and so easy to make with ingredients from your own kitchen. Here’s how to make playdough at home. Combine the flour, salt and cream of tartar in a large saucepan. Mix everything together well. In a 2 cup liquid measure, combine the water, vegetable oil and koolaid. Pour into the saucepan. Cook over a medium heat, stirring frequently until the mixture forms a ball. Remove from heat. Knead the playdough a few times when it has cooled down. Store it in a large ziplock bag. Be sure to replace your playdough frequently as germs can be spread through the constant touching. Use different colored Koolaid to make different colored playdough according to the season e.g. Orange playdough for Fall/Halloween. Playdough is easy to make in your own home and makes for hours of fun!
